ENSR AD 2.20  Local aerodrome regulations

1  AD availability
1.1 Except for emergency situations AD shall not be used by CIV or MIL ACFT with wingspan exceeding 26 M. Other exceptions will not be granted.
2  Additional requirements
2.1 CAA Norway has published a regulation, in Norwegian language only, with additional requirements for commercial operations on short-field runways.
Reference to this regulation can be found in AIP GEN 1.6
3  Engine testing area
3.1 Engine testing above idle are performed at RWY end / turning pad RWY 14/32, depending on RWY-in-use.

ENSR AD 2.22  Flight Procedures

1  Procedure in reduced visibility
1.1 Marking and lights REF ENSR AD 2.9, 2.14 and AD 2 ENSR 2-1
1.2 RVR 800 M and less:
  • Secondary power supply activated to ensure reaction
    in 1 - one - second,

  • Only 1 - one - aircraft allowed on the manoeuvring area at the time. No vehicles allowed on the manoeuvring area except for follow-me service and RVR measuring.

1.3 RVR 550 M or less:
  • LVP not established. No aircraft movements allowed.

2  Radio communication failure
2.1 If experiencing radio communication failure when flying VFR in TIZ (REF AD 2 ENSR 6 - 1):
  1. Squawk 7600,

  2. Proceed via routes as shown on AD 2 ENSR 6 - 1
    and hold at 750 FT,

  3. Flash LDG LGT,

  4. Watch TWR for visual signals.

ENSR AD 2.23  Additional Information

1  Differences from ICAO Annex 14 SARPS
1.1 ACFT on apron constitutes an obstacle on the strip, REF para 3.4.6 and 9.9.
1.2 Slopes on parts of the strip and RESA are steeper than prescribed, REF para 3.4.3, 3.4.15, 3.5.9 and 3.5.10.
1.3 Undershoot RESA RWY 32 is not established, REF para 3.5.3.
1.4 Aiming points are 150 M from THR, REF para 5.2.5.3.
1.5 “RWY AHEAD” is used as mandatory instruction marking, REF para 5.2.16.
1.6 PLASI is used as visual slope indicator, on right hand side, REF para 5.3.5.4 and 5.3.5.27.
1.7 RWY holding signs are not illuminated according to specifications, REF para 5.4.1.7
1.8 Simple touchdown zone lights are replaced by balked LDG guidance lights. REF para 5.3.14.
2  Approach and runway lights
2.1 The APCH LGT and the lights at the aerodrome may be activated automatically, REF AD 1.1.
2.2 «Balked LDG guidance lights» installed, 2 Y LGTS outside each edge of RWY, in a given distance after THR, REF AD 2.14.10.
3  Special requirements for aircraft operators performing commercial transportation into Sørkjosen airport
3.1 The aircraft operator shall establish crew qualification requirements; route and aerodrome competence qualification according to EASA AMC1 ORO.FC.105. The qualification shall be as required for aerodrome category C.
3.2 The aircraft operator shall stipulate special limitations with regard to upper wind.
3.3 Aircraft operators without steep approach approval shall describe how the flight crew shall use the visual aids (visual approach guidance system and runway markings).
3.4 Departure procedures, take-off minima, take-off weight limitations shall be documented.
3.5 The aircraft operator shall document fulfilment of the requirements above to CAA Norway at least 14 days prior to commencing operations. Instructions on how to declare compliance is listed in a downloadable pdf-file here: https://avinor.no/en/ais/pilot-briefing/. CAA Norway will, after evaluating the documentation and finding it adequate, issue a letter of compliance. A copy of this letter has to be carried by the crew and presented to local airport authorities or representatives of CAA Norway on request.
3.6 Dual PLASI RWY 32 is only available to operators fulfilling the above mentioned requirements in addition to having terrain avoidance system and steep approach approval.
4  Caution
4.1 Moderate, occasionally severe, turbulence and wind shear may occur on final to RWY 14 and 32 at wind SW-W more than 40 KT. The turbulence often decreases on short final resulting in wind shear with loss of height.
4.2 In voice communication from ATS, including ATIS, wind direction is given as magnetic direction.
In written communication, METAR, SPECI and TAF, the geographical wind direction is given. Hence, there will be a difference between wind direction given orally from ATS, including ATIS, and written MET information.
